业务架构建模8步法指南及其成功关键要素
The following article is from 数字化转型战略指南 Author Long
我们先举个简单的例子,看看业务架构建模图是怎么画出来的?
(黄色是职能,蓝色是功能,虚线是数据,实线是流程)
我称之为业务建模8步法:
1 需求分析:对业务开展过程的全面审视,而不是对流程图本身形式的审视。不仅要关注流程的运作细节,更要深入探究各个环节与主要业务路径的关联。这一步骤的核心在于理解流程的整体架构,掌握流程与业务目标之间的内在联系,确保对业务需求的全面把握。通过需求分析,构建一个既符合实际业务场景又具备可操作性的业务蓝图。这块是最考验架构师水平的了,没有放之四海而皆准的方法论,资深架构师往往有一套自己的打法。有些企业联系我去做业务需求分析培训,总是在问有什么好的方法,之前企业吧啦吧啦已经培训好几个了,市面上还有什么可以培训呢?如果从这个角度来讲,培训工作和架构工作也就到头了,因为方法论就那么几个,培训也好架构也好也都要围绕着业务的需求来开展,要解决什么问题?怎么解决?方法论是哲学层面的问题,企业要的是探究解决自身问题的分析方法与解决办法。之前看过某前辈写的一篇文章,他竟然也有感同身受。
2 流程识别:对业务流程细分和定位,它的重点在于找出那些与企业运营密切相关的关键业务流程,如客户服务流程、生产流程、销售规划流程、生产管理流程、仓库管理流程以及交付流程等。在这一步骤中,我们不仅要识别出这些关键流程,还要明确它们内部的与外部的逻辑关系。
3 系统映射:将每个业务流程映射到相应的企业系统功能上去,例如客户关系管理(CRM)、企业资源规划(ERP)、生产系统和仓库应用程序等。这就是传说中的业务找应用了,也是很多BA最繁忙的领域。
4 数据流分析:分析不同系统之间的数据流动,例如客户数据、物料数据、订单数据、产品数据和交付数据等,以及这些数据如何在各个系统间传递和处理。
5 图形设计:使用图形设计软件(如Microsoft Visio、Lucidchart、Draw.io等)来绘制流程图。清晰地表示业务流程和系统关系。
6 迭代优化:在绘制过程中,需要与业务owner和系统分析师一起,注意,是一起,进行多次讨论和反馈,以确保图表准确地反映了实际的业务流程和系统架构,只跟系统分析师沟通,那只能是自嗨,你俩画的流程再漂亮也不一定有啥价值。
7 审查和验证:完成初稿后,需要对图表进行审查和验证,确保所有信息都是准确无误的,并且图表能够清晰地传达预期的信息。此时抓关键人沟通确认即可,我见过的一种非常愚蠢的管理方法就是叫一堆人七嘴八舌的来讨论这个流程合不合适,然后这个业务流程废了,哈哈....如果管理人员不懂得科学的工作方法,那谁也救不了。
8 最终呈现:最后,将图表格式化并添加必要的标签和说明,确保图表既美观又易于理解,形成完整的漂亮的领域数据视图,帅气!
是的,如上例,业务架构建模逻辑清晰而简洁。但令人疑惑的是,在国内业务架构真正得其精髓者寥寥无几。其定义与价值常被混淆,如盲人摸象,说法不一,令人难窥其貌,很多人停留在看材料上,只看SOP不下水永远不会游泳!是的,你看的是材料A,他看的是材料B,哈哈,所以总是在争吵,材料能对齐还是实践的体会能对齐?
最近我们的数转风暴群对数转顶层设计做了一次深入交流,我惊奇的发现,居然不同角色的朋友(业务流程架构师、业务OWNER、战略顾问、CFO、公司董事)在类似的领域实践上有共性的认识,这绝不是偶然啊,这是来自于一个又一个客观实践的碰撞与反馈。深度在哪里?在于实践。高度在哪里?在于理论。广度在哪里?在于视野。
那么业务架构到底是什么?简单来说,它如同一张详尽的地图,描绘出组织内部各个运营职能之间的关联与互动。这些职能需以优化价值传递、实现战略优先事项为目标,相互融合、相互支撑。
业务架构,其定义虽多,但无需过于纠结于某个方法论,方法论往往是元抽象结果,犹如它通过无数次实践发现了水是由氢和氧组成的,这是看起来正确的结论,但是企业如何用水呢?答案只能在自己的实践中寻找。
我们可以将业务架构视为一种展现组织元素(如人员、流程、信息、应用等,具体元素因企业而异,所谓4A架构好像都说到了,但是每个人理解的都千差万别)如何协同工作以定义企业的规范。深入了解这些关系,有助于组织识别发展机会、制定发展路线,进而将战略与业务运营紧密相连。
一旦业务架构得到有效实施,它便成为战略投资组合管理的得力助手。它能够将战略目标与工作执行、战术需求以更有效、更注重价值的方式联系起来,从而推动业务绩效的持续提升。因此,我们必须将其视为涵盖所有组织要素的战略性、以业务为中心的学科。
要实现业务架构的价值最大化,需从多个角度审视业务,将各个角度结合起来,以全面了解组织的现状和未来发展方向。以下是实现有效业务架构的五个关键要素:
一是能力映射。通过绘制业务能力图,我们可以清晰地看到组织所具备的独特能力。这不仅是业务架构师的起点,更是理解业务基础的关键。进一步的能力分析,将涉及对流程、人员、技术、信息等多方面的考量,以揭示组织的优势、机会及需要调整之处。
二是组织映射。组织结构图,如同组织的骨架图,展现了各个架构实体及功能区域之间的关系。结合第三方和协作团队的信息,我们可以获得更完整的组织关系图。这一地图不仅有助于我们了解组织的全貌,更能与其他地图和模型相结合,为业务运营提供更深入的分析和沟通工具。
三是价值流图和交叉图。价值流,作为向客户传递价值的一系列活动,是业务架构中的核心要素。通过绘制价值流图,我们可以直观地看到组织如何通过一系列活动实现价值。而当多个价值流与其他元素交叉建模时,我们便能洞察到复杂的概念,并对每个阶段进行详细分析。这有助于我们更深入地理解业务运营方式,为战略规划和投资分解提供有力支持。
四是过程建模。流程建模作为业务架构中的成熟元素,已经在许多组织中得到应用。然而,在业务架构的框架下,流程建模的价值得以进一步体现。通过将流程模型与其他元素相结合,我们可以深入探索每个阶段的细节,从而更全面地理解当前或提议的状态,消除潜在的混淆。
五是成熟度建模。有效的业务架构不仅要关注组织做了什么和如何做,更要关注组织的优势和劣势、需要调整的地方以及计划对进展的贡献。成熟度建模正是实现这一目标的关键工具。通过调查利益相关者的意见,我们可以了解组织在各方面的相对性能,进而为规划、调整工作方向以及优化资源配置提供有力依据。
业务架构师所面对的挑战
业务架构师在履职过程中,常常会遇到一系列棘手挑战。这些挑战多数源于未能通过企业级的战略投资组合管理方法有效解决的难题。因此,将业务架构置于更广阔的投资管理和业务战略背景下考虑,才能充分发挥其效用,实现价值的最大化。
首要挑战在于未能明确定义和传达业务战略。若整个组织对战略优先事项及其实现路径缺乏共识,业务架构师便难以确保所有组织元素的一致性。这不仅需要明确业务架构的定位,还需要区分它与企业架构的不同之处。一旦这种一致性缺失,围绕业务战略的挑战便会加剧。
其次,企业内部存在的运营孤岛也是一大障碍。传统的战略规划方法往往助长了部门和职能孤岛的形成,这些孤岛允许业务单位以相对自主的方式运营,却未能与组织优先事项保持一致。这些孤岛犹如业务架构道路上的绊脚石,阻碍了通过有效整合所有元素而产生的协同效应。
再者,业务和IT职能部门之间缺乏紧密的合作关系也是业务架构师需要面对的问题。业务架构并非仅限于IT功能,而是涉及整个企业的规程。然而,其要素要求在所有业务领域和业务环境中有效运用技术。若业务和IT领导未能将其视为业务的延伸,那么业务架构的实现便无从谈起。
业务架构一般来讲服务于四个关键领域:组织、功能、价值流和信息。组织是业务架构所应用的生产关系结构,由代表企业内所有职能和部门的业务单位组成。职能是组织做什么或能做什么的定义,每种职能都是独一无二的。价值流是通过一系列活动交付价值的过程的可视化描述,每个价值流都是独立的,并向内部或外部客户交付结果。信息则是推动对企业运营方式的了解和理解的燃料,建立在组织的数据之上,但需要通过上下文来理解其意义。
要克服这些挑战,我们需要采用恰当的业务架构流程和工具。许多组织在业务架构实践中常常陷入倒退的境地,未能有意识地致力于开发规程,而是简单地将过程建模扩展到业务过程中。因此,选择适合支持业务架构功能的软件解决方案至关重要。我们需要一个强大的企业解决方案,能够认识到连接和集成业务的每个元素是一切的基础。这样的解决方案不仅能够帮助我们定义、分析和可视化业务,还能将分析无缝集成到战略投资组合管理的其余部分中。
通过使用这样的解决方案,业务架构师能够提供必要的洞察力,确保企业能够将战略目标与正确的投资相结合,从而推动整个组织价值的优化。同时,它还能消除常常成为绩效障碍的孤岛,为整个企业的所有工作团队提供必要的背景和理解。这是单纯使用如Visio等工具所无法实现的。
那么行业里哪些方案和工具是可以考察使用的呢?
1 SAP Business Suite,作为一套全面的业务流程管理工具,集ERP、CRM与SCM功能于一身,不仅支持业务架构建模、数据分析与实时监控,更能让用户轻松创建业务流程图,定义业务规则与数据流,并通过可视化工具不断优化流程,实现业务的高效运转。
2 Oracle E-Business Suite则聚焦企业各领域业务功能的整合,包括财务、人力资源和供应链等。它提供业务流程建模与分析工具,帮助用户洞察流程瓶颈,把握改进机会,并通过数据整合与分析,助力用户制定精准的战略决策。
3 IBM Blueworks Live作为一款基于云的业务流程建模工具,强调协作式流程设计。用户可与团队成员共同创建和优化流程,工具提供的流程模拟、分析与可视化功能,让组织在优化业务流程的道路上更加得心应手。
4 Microsoft Dynamics 365,集ERP与CRM功能于一身,为企业提供全面的业务管理解决方案。它支持业务流程建模与数据分析,用户可借助可视化工具轻松创建与优化业务流程,并将分析与战略投资组合管理无缝集成,实现业务价值的最大化。
5 Salesforce,作为云计算领域的CRM翘楚,涵盖销售、服务与营销等核心功能。用户可利用其可视化工具创建并分析业务流程,同时支持与其他系统的集成,为企业提供全面的业务数据与洞察,助力企业洞察市场,抢占先机。
6 MEGA HOPEX,作为一款业务架构与风险管理工具,不仅支持业务流程建模、风险评估与战略规划,更能帮助企业实现从战略到运营的全面建模与分析,优化业务流程,提升运营效率。
7 ARIS,以其强大的业务流程管理功能著称。它提供流程建模、模拟与监控的全方位支持,帮助用户识别并消除流程中的瓶颈,提升工作效率,推动企业不断向前发展。
8 Sparx Systems Enterprise Architect,作为一款全面的建模工具,既支持业务架构的搭建,又兼顾系统设计的需要。用户可轻松创建业务流程图、数据模型和架构图,通过协作式建模与分析,实现业务架构的目标,推动企业数字化转型。
9 iGrafx,作为业务流程管理与分析领域的佼佼者,为用户提供流程建模、优化与绩效监控的全方位服务。其流程模拟与分析功能,助力企业实现业务流程的持续改进,不断提升竞争力。
10 Planview,作为一款战略投资组合管理与项目管理工具,不仅支持业务流程建模与优化,更能帮助企业实现战略目标。用户可通过Planview整合数据与分析,制定精准的战略决策,推动企业稳健发展。
业务架构建模关键成功要素
高层支持与领导力,是业务架构建模能成功的基本前提。有高层领导的坚定转型意愿与鼎力支持,才可能确保整个项目稳健前行,如果上面对这个事漠不关心甚至质疑其意义,那段然业务架构师及相关团队即便耗费再多心血也无济于事。领导层需倾注力量,调配资源,为业务架构团队提供必要保障,在遇到困难的时候能够帮助他们披荆斩棘,使工作顺利展开。
业务战略与目标,是业务架构的大脑。架构的构建,务必紧紧围绕企业战略,确保每一环节均精准反映企业发展的方向与重点。如此,方能确保业务架构与企业战略相得益彰。
全面理解业务,是构建有效架构的灵魂。深入洞察企业的业务需求、流程及操作模式,方能洞悉企业的核心竞争力、市场定位及客户需求。这是构建业务架构不可或缺的环节,业务架构设计难在哪里?不在于从系统或者方法论里找答案、那是厂商设计的...而是应该在自己企业的业务战场中找答案。
跨部门协作与沟通,是业务架构建模的桥梁。多部门、多团队共同参与,需建立有效沟通机制,确保信息共享、减少误解、避免打仗,促进业务架构顺利实施。当不同团队对目标各执一词时,即便性格再好的人也会被逼的崩溃。
灵活性与可扩展性,是业务架构生命力所在。市场风云变幻,业务创新层出不穷。业务架构设计需具备应变能力,快速响应市场变化,满足业务创新需求。为什么庞大的、僵硬的、脱离实际的架构不可能产生价值?因为架构设计的意义在于更好的反映业务并服务于业务,而不是为了改造而改造。所以每个企业的业务架构都没有定论,且这些架构都是企业的核心资产,因为从中衍生着他们企业的业务价值,否则就是一堆废纸。
稳定性与可靠性,是业务架构的基石。追求稳定运行、降低风险、提高业务连续性,方能确保企业在变化多端的市场环境中稳健发展。
标准化与模块化,是提升业务架构效能的之捷径。采用标准化设计元素与模块化架构组件,可提高业务架构的可重用性与可维护性,降低企业运营成本与维护成本。这部分可以读一读《聚合架构》。
持续改进与优化,生生不息的业务架构...随着业务发展与技术进步,业务架构需不断进行调整与优化,以保持其有效性与适应性。业务架构必须要追求卓越而不是被动的被用户来推动修整。
培训与知识管理,是提升团队能力的关键。为员工提供业务架构相关培训与知识管理、认证管理,可提升团队的专业技能与综合素质,确保他们能够有效实施与维护业务架构。这是推动企业持续发展之根本保障。
解锁企业架构:漫画版TOGAF框架,让初学者也能游刃有余! 2375
如何画一张人见人爱的应用架构图?3711
如何画出一张清晰而专业的技术架构图? 3108
怎样画一张人见人爱的业务架构图?6202